== Pilot Churn: Restricted to Managers ==

Sales leads should note that the Quillbrook pilot lost 11 of 60 enrolled customers in month two, mostly citing onboarding friction rather than price. Remediation steps are underway and exit interviews are documented on the sub-page. The wider implications for the programme are set out in the confidential note below.

internal memo for kajef-kahof: The steering committee signed off on a budget of $33.6 million for Project Quenmir. The renewal with Ralionox Partners closes at $54.7 million a year, 38 percent below the last contract.

**Action Item 12 (image slimming):** The Copperhollow deploy stalls traced back to bloated base images — each service shipped a full toolchain it never used. We have since adopted multi-stage builds with a minimal runtime layer, and the registry now rejects images over the size ceiling. New team members should understand that these limits are enforced in CI, not merely advisory, and exceptions require platform approval. The enforcement thresholds are configured as follows.

tuning table, kajog-kawef:
PRIORITIES = {
    "kelox": 870,
    "kasix": 89,
    "eliax": 988,
}

## Bike cage and parking gates — Harlow Point campus

New starters: the bike cage sits behind Building C, next to the loading bay. The parking gates on Millbrook Lane open automatically on exit but require a badge tap on entry between 06:00 and 20:00; outside those hours they stay locked. Your standard badge covers the gates once Facilities activates it, usually within two days of your start date. The bike cage uses a separate keypad rather than a badge reader, and its code is below.

turnstile pass: bdg-FVNQRS-72965873

Management Meeting Minutes — Logistics Transition

Attendees: Orrin Vale, Tessa Lindqvist, Marcus Obeyo.

Decision: terminate the Carroway Freight contract at year end; Nordpace Logistics takes over all regional routes. Reasons: repeated delays on the Ellsmere corridor and rising surcharge disputes. Sales leads must flag affected customer delivery windows by next Thursday. Transition team forms Monday under Tessa. No customer notices yet. The confidential business note is appended below.

confidential, tagag-kahof: Rusathox Partners plans to lower the Gorox list price by 63 percent in December.